Samuel Johnson's Dictionary
Snagged, Snaggyadjective
Full of snags; full of sharp protuberances; shooting into sharp points.
Etymology: from snag.
His stalking steps are stay’d
Upon a snaggy oak, which he had torn
Out of his mother’s bowels, and it made
His mortal mace, wherewith his foemen he dismay’d. Edmund Spenser.Naked men belabouring one another with snagged sticks, or dully falling together by the ears at fisty-cuffs. More.
